A Financial Advisor is a professional who provides advice on financial matters to clients and assists them in achieving their goals in life and business. They are involved in the process of financial planning to their clients and are in the process of helping individuals achieve their personal and financial goals.

Financial Advisor is a rewarding career in India for finance professionals, as there are thousands of opportunities in the job market. As a Finance Advisor, a professional can work in any organization or business that can be public, private, or government. Based on the country's current population growth rate and the rising disposable income of both retail and HNI (High Networth Individuals) customers, the wealth management and Financial Advisory business is probably projected to increase at a pace of between 15 to 25% per year over the next ten years.
Financial Adviser positions are in high demand in major cities like Delhi, Mumbai, and Bengaluru. According to the BLS (US Bureau of Labor Statistics), financial advisers' overall employment is anticipated to grow by 7% between 2018 and 2028, faster than the average for all occupations and professions.
